What makes a good teacher

[This letter was originally published in the New York Daily News on Jan. 13, 2012.]

Bronx: Re “Mulgrew vs. the kids” (editorial, Jan. 8): I want to thank the Daily News for recognizing how important teachers are to a young person’s life. However, the way to measure a teacher’s worth is not just by a score on a test. The United Federation of Teachers has agreed to have a teacher evaluation system based on test scores. However, there was also a recognition that good teaching is not just test scores, but student work throughout the year.

UFT member Michael Friedman
